The ideal room temperature for sleep is anywhere from 60°f to 65°f (15.6°c to 18.3°c.) however, everyone is different, and this temperature may not work for you. A new study shows they optimal sleep temperature for quality sleep is between 20 and 25 °c (68 and 77 f). Experts suggest an air temperature between about 65 and 68 degrees fahrenheit is optimal for sleeping. Healthcare providers and researchers recommend that you sleep at a temperature between 60 and 68 degrees, often noting that 65 degrees is a safe bet. For most adults, the best temperature for sleep is 60 to 67 degrees fahrenheit (15 to 19 degrees celsius). However, this will also depend on personal preferences.
